Abstract

一种柔性显示装置的制备方法,该方法包括:提供一基板(100),基板包括相对设置的第一表面(100a)及第二表面(100b);在基板的第一表面上形成第一柔性基板(110),在基板的第二表面上形成第二柔性基板(120),其中,第一柔性基板对基板的作用力与第二柔性基板对基板的作用力大小相等,方向相反;在第一柔性基板远离基板的表面上形成显示器件;将形成有显示器件的第一柔性基板从基板上剥离,以形成一柔性显示装置。该方法制备出来的柔性显示装置具有较高的品质。

技术领域
本发明涉及显示领域,尤其涉及一种柔性显示装置的制备方法。
背景技术
随着科技的进步,柔性显示显技术得到快速的发展。现有的柔性显示装置的制备方法一般为在一玻璃基板的一表面上形成一层很薄的塑料基板,在塑料基板上形成柔性显示器件等器件。再将形成有柔性显示器件的塑料基板从玻璃基板上剥离下来,以形成柔性显示装置。然而,在形成柔性显示器件等器件时需要经过高温制程。由于塑料基板和玻璃基板热胀冷缩的程度不一致,从而导致塑料基板的边缘会发生翘起,造成了柔性显示装置的品质不良。

上述各个实施方式的柔性显示装置的制备方法中,当所述第一柔性基板及所述第二柔性基板遇热时,由于第一柔性基板的收缩量比玻璃基板的收缩量大,因此,所述第一柔性基板会施加到所述玻璃基板一个作用力,命名为第一作用力。在所述第一作用力的作用下,所述第一柔性基板扯着所述玻璃基板朝上收缩。而,由于所述基板的第二表面上形成第二柔性基板,第二柔性基板遇热时,由于所述第二柔性基板的收缩量比所述玻璃基板的收缩量大,因此,所述第二柔性基板会施加到所述玻璃基板一个作用力,命名为第二作用力。在所述第二作用力的作用下,所述第二柔性基板扯着所述玻璃基板朝下收缩。由于所述第一作用力与所述第二作用力大小相等,方向相反,所述第一作用力及所述第二作用力相互抵消,从而避免了所述第一柔性基板、第二柔性基板及所述基板的翘起变形,从而提高了所述柔性显示装置的品质。

请一并参阅图1,其为本发明第一较佳实施方式的柔性显示装置的制备方法的流程图。所述柔性显示装置10的制备方法包括但不仅限于以下步骤。
步骤S101,提供一基板100,所述基板100包括相对设置的第一表面100a及第二表面100b。请一并参阅图2,所述基板100可以为一玻璃基板,所述玻璃基板可以为超薄玻璃基板,所述玻璃基板的厚度小于或等于0.1mm。
步骤S102,在所述基板100的第一表面100a形成第一柔性基板110,在所述基板100的第二表面100b形成第二柔性基板120,其中,所述第一柔性基板110对所述基板100的作用力与所述第二基板120对所述基板100的作用力大小相等,方向相反。
请一并参阅图3,在所述基板100的第一表面100a及第二表面100b分别形成所述第一柔性基板110及所述第二柔性基板120。在本实施方式中,所述第一柔性基板110及所述第二柔性基板120为塑料基板,所述塑料基板的材料包括聚碳酸酯、聚对苯二甲酸乙二醇酯、聚酰亚胺、聚芳酯、聚醚砜、聚萘二甲酸乙二醇酯或纤维强化塑料的一种或者两种及两种以上的组合。
由于所述第一柔性基板110对所述基板100的作用力与所述第二基板120 对所述基板100的作用力大小相等方向相反。当所述第一柔性基板110及所述第二柔性基板120遇热时,由于第一柔性基板110的收缩量比玻璃基板的收缩量大,因此,所述第一柔性基板110会施加到所述玻璃基板一个作用力,命名为第一作用力。在所述第一作用力的作用下,所述第一柔性基板110扯着所述玻璃基板朝上收缩。而,由于所述基板100的第二表面100b上形成第二柔性基板120,第二柔性基板120遇热时,由于所述第二柔性基板110的收缩量比所述玻璃基板的收缩量大,因此,所述第二柔性基板120会施加到所述玻璃基板一个作用力,命名为第二作用力。在所述第二作用力的作用下,所述第二柔性基板扯着所述玻璃基板朝下收缩。由于所述第一作用力与所述第二作用力大小相等,方向相反,所述第一作用力及所述第二作用力相互抵消,从而避免了所述第一柔性基板110、第二柔性基板120及所述基板100的翘起变形,从而提高了所述柔性显示装置的品质。
在一实施方式中,在所述步骤S102中,通过粘结剂将所述第一柔性基板110粘结在所述基板100第一表面100a上,通过粘结剂将所述第二柔性基板120粘结在所述基板100的第二表面110b上。
在另一实施方式中,在所述步骤S102中,通过大气压力将所述第一柔性基板110设置在所述基板100的第一表面100a上,通过大气压力将所述第二柔性基板120设置在所述基板100的第二表面100b上。
步骤S103,在所述第一柔性基板110远离所述基板100的表面形成显示器件130。请一并参阅图4,在所述第一柔性基板110包括两相对的表面,所述第一柔性基板110通过其中的一个表面形成在所述基板100的第一表面100a,所述第一柔性基板100的另一表面形成所述显示器件130。所述显示器件可以为液晶显示器、有机电致发光显示器、电子纸、电泳式显示器、触摸屏、薄膜光伏电池中的一种或两种及两种以上的组合。
优选地,在所述步骤S103之后,所述柔性显示装置10的制备方法还包括:在所述第一柔性基板110远离所述基板100的表面形成所述显示器件130的驱动电路140。请一并参阅图5,所述驱动电路140用于驱动所述显示器件130。可以理解地,在其他实施方式中,在所述第一柔性基板110远离所述基板100的表面形成所述显示器件130的驱动电路140也可以和在所述第一柔性基板 110远离所述基板100的表面形成显示器件130在同一步骤中完成。
步骤S104,将形成有所述显示器件130的所述第一柔性基板110从所述基板100上剥离,以形成一柔性显示装置10。请一并参阅图6,形成有所述显示器件130的所述第一柔性基板110从所述基板100的所述第一表面100a上剥离下来,所述第一柔性基板100及形成在所述第一柔性基板100的表面的显示器件130构成所述柔性显示装置10。
步骤S105,在所述基板100的所述第一表面100a形成第一柔性基板110。请一并参阅图7,所述基板100的所述第一表面100a上再次形成一第一柔性基板110。
步骤S106,在所述第一柔性基板110远离所述基板100的表面形成显示器件130。请一并参阅图8,在所述第一柔性基板110包括两相对的表面,所述第一柔性基板110通过其中的一个表面形成在所述基板100的第一表面100a,所述第一柔性基板100的另一表面形成所述显示器件130。所述显示器件可以为液晶显示器、有机电致发光显示器、电子纸、电泳式显示器、触摸屏、薄膜光伏电池中的一种或两种及两种以上的组合。
优选地,在所述步骤S106之后,所述柔性显示装置10的制备方法还包括:在所述第一柔性基板110远离所述基板100的表面形成所述显示器件130的驱动电路140。所述驱动电路140用于驱动所述显示器件130。可以理解地,在其他实施方式中,在所述第一柔性基板110远离所述基板100的表面形成所述显示器件130的驱动电路140也可以和在所述第一柔性基板110远离所述基板100的表面形成显示器件130在同一步骤中完成。
步骤S107,将形成有所述显示器件130的所述第一柔性基板110从所述基板100上剥离,以形成又一柔性显示装置10。请一并参阅图9,形成有所述显示器件130的所述第一柔性基板110从所述基板100的所述第一表面100a上剥离下来,所述第一柔性基板100及形成在所述第一柔性基板100的表面的显示器件130构成所述柔性显示装置10。
在所述步骤S104之后重复执行所述步骤S105-S107,以循环使用在所述第二表面110b上设置第二柔性基板120的基板10,以生成多个柔性显示装置10。
